Ordinals
beta
Address 1DsLkTadqvNWUXXcHRxSyyigPw3by4HpLZ
sat balance
3
outputs
2a95436014b34e63caf56ea93136e3f1a50b12858569a37300bc679fc93b9600:658
3b2a8345a46234d622ef7d0d3d468fc78c5b38f134a0b511c39244138ffd1302:135
3806ba18593092ed6d7d5d088a891a6dda1c228dc2582788b539930e6b4a3a6b:658